您好, 欢迎来到 !    登录 | 注册 | | 设为首页 | 收藏本站

SQL查询-从视图中选择*或从视图中选择col1,col2,colN

SQL查询-从视图中选择*或从视图中选择col1,col2,colN

永远不要使用“选择*” !!!!

这是查询设计的基本规则!

这有多种原因。其中之一是,如果您的表上只有三个字段,并且您使用了调用查询代码中的所有三个字段,则很有可能会随着应用程序的增长而向该表中添加更多字段,并且您的select *查询仅用于返回调用代码的这3个字段,那么您从数据库提取的数据量远远超出了您的需要。

一个原因是性能。在查询设计中,不要像这个口头禅那样考虑可重用性:

尽您所能,但尽您所能。

SQLServer 2022/1/1 18:49:12 有607人围观

撰写回答


你尚未登录,登录后可以

和开发者交流问题的细节

关注并接收问题和回答的更新提醒

参与内容的编辑和改进,让解决方法与时俱进

请先登录

推荐问题


联系我
置顶